Fans Protest Lack Of Aussie Performers At AFL GF

The message is clear: We want local talent.

Aussie fans are outraged following yesterday's news that international acts Bryan Adams, Ellie Goulding and Chris Issak will be headlining the AFL grand final's pre-game show, due to the fact that no national acts will be performing at one of the country's most popular sporting events. 

While the AFL have a history of nominating hugely successful overseas talent such as last year's pairing of Ed Sheeran and Tom Jones, not to mention this year's Brownlow Medal ceremony which will also feature a performance from UK singer James Blunt, it seems fans have finally had enough and a petition has been launched calling for more local bands to take to the stage at the MCG on 3 October. 

The new Change.org petition is fighting to get support behind popular Aussie acts such as King Gizzard & The Lizard Wizard, Pond and Bad//Dreems in favour of the international stars, because, as the petition reads, "they are trying to make it something that it is not, it's not the NFL half time show and never will be."

The petition continues, "We have a bunch of world class rad bands in this country that have been brought up with the love of footy."

"Bands such as Pond, King Gizzard and Lizard Wizard and Bad Dreems have been independently touring the world honing their craft and captivating fans across the globe. THESE are the perfect Australian bands to fire up the ā€˜G’ before 2015 Granny and deserve more than anyone the chance to perform on the grandest stage of them all."

Interestingly, as SMH reports, AFL chief Gillon McLachlan revealed the artist's chosen were suggestions made within the family. 

"I spoke to my daughters. They chose Ellie Goulding," McLachlan said.

"Bryan Adams' Summer of 69 is a personal favourite. They're both big international artists. They cater for a broad audience that is the Grand Final audience and we're lucky to have them. It'll be a great day."

Meanwhile, AFL's rival sporting code in rugby league's NRL, have already confirmed that Aussie legends Cold Chisel will headline its own grand final on 4 October.
